What Is Mixed Pattern Styling?
Mixed pattern styling is the art of combining two or more patterns in a single outfit to create visually striking, cohesive looks. Rather than matching a single pattern from head to toe, this technique involves strategically pairing different prints—such as stripes with florals, checks with animal print, or geometric patterns with abstract designs—to achieve a balanced yet dynamic aesthetic. Essential Rules for Mixing Patterns Successfully
Balance Scale with Proportion
The foundation of successful pattern mixing lies in proportion. When combining patterns, ensure one dominates the outfit while the other serves as an accent. If your top features a large-scale floral print, pair it with smaller-scale patterns below, such as pinstripes or small dots. This creates visual hierarchy that the eye can follow comfortably.
Unify Through Color
Colors act as the bridge that makes disparate patterns feel intentional rather than chaotic. Choose patterns that share at least one common color—perhaps a navy stripe top paired with a navy floral skirt. The shared color palette creates cohesion even when the prints differ dramatically in style and scale.
Vary Pattern Categories
Combine patterns from different categories for maximum visual interest. Pair structured patterns like checks or houndstooth with organic patterns like florals or abstract prints. Combining geometric shapes with curved forms creates tension and movement that keeps viewers engaged throughout your video.
Trust Negative Space
Strategic use of solid colors between patterns prevents visual overwhelm. A solid belt, bag, or shoes can break up multiple patterns and give the eye places to rest. This technique proves especially valuable in video content where quick visual processing is essential.
How to Style Mixed Patterns for Short-Form Video Content
Opening Shots That Showcase the Mix
Your video's opening seconds determine whether viewers stay or scroll. Start with a full-body reveal that shows the pattern combination in its entirety. Consider beginning with a wide shot of the complete outfit before transitioning to detail shots of specific pattern pairings. This approach lets viewers appreciate your styling choices while maintaining narrative momentum.
Detail-Focused Transitions
Pattern mixing provides natural opportunities for close-up shots that highlight texture and print interplay. Create transitions by zooming from one pattern element to another—perhaps from the polka dot collar to the plaid trousers. These micro-movements showcase your attention to detail and demonstrate genuine styling expertise.
Add Movement for Visual Impact
Patterns behave differently when fabric moves. Include moments where you walk, turn, or adjust your clothing to show how patterns interact dynamically. This movement adds production value to your content and gives viewers multiple angles to appreciate your styling choices.

Common Mixed Pattern Styling Mistakes to Avoid
- Mixing patterns of identical scale, which creates visual competition rather than harmonyCombining more than three distinct patterns without using solid connectorsIgnoring color relationships between pattern elementsChoosing patterns with competing energy levels, such as two busy prints without balanceFailing to consider the overall silhouette when pattern density increases

Frequently Asked Questions
What patterns go well together when mixing outfits?
Stripes pair excellently with florals, animal prints complement geometric patterns, and checks work beautifully with abstract prints. The key is ensuring patterns differ in scale and style while sharing at least one color. Structured patterns balance organic ones, creating visual harmony from contrasting elements.
Can beginners try mixed pattern styling?
Absolutely! Start by mixing two patterns in neutral colors—a striped top with plaid trousers in black and white, for example. Build confidence gradually before attempting bolder color combinations or three-pattern outfits. The goal is creating intentional combinations that feel curated rather than chaotic.
How do fashion videos showcase pattern mixing effectively?
Successful fashion videos capture the full outfit first, then transition to detail shots that highlight specific pattern interactions. Movement shots demonstrate how patterns behave when fabric flows. Lighting should emphasize texture differences between prints, and editing should maintain smooth pacing that lets viewers appreciate each styling choice.
Does mixed pattern styling work for all body types?
Mixed pattern styling adapts to any body type by adjusting pattern placement strategically. Larger-scale patterns draw attention to preferred areas while smaller patterns recede. Structured patterns can create definition, while fluid patterns add movement. The principles remain consistent regardless of body type, with execution adjusted for individual proportions.
